Kattankudy

Kattankudy is a dynamic and culturally rich town located on the eastern coast of Sri Lanka, just south of Batticaloa. Recognized as one of the most densely populated towns in South Asia, Kattankudy is predominantly inhabited by a vibrant Muslim community that has shaped the town’s distinctive identity. The area is well known for its deep-rooted Islamic traditions, which are reflected in its many mosques, Islamic schools (madrasas), and cultural practices.

Kattankudy has long been a center of trade, education, and religious scholarship. Its busy streets are lined with a wide array of shops, markets, eateries, and small industries, contributing to a strong local economy driven by entrepreneurship and commerce. The town’s coastal location also supports a modest fishing industry, adding to its economic and cultural ties with the sea.

The people of Kattankudy are known for their hospitality, vibrant attire, and commitment to preserving their religious and cultural values. Festivals such as Eid-ul-Fitr and Milad-un-Nabi are celebrated with great enthusiasm, bringing the community together in colorful displays of faith and unity.

Over the years, Kattankudy has experienced growth in infrastructure, education, and public services, with modern schools, healthcare facilities, and places of worship enhancing quality of life. Despite its compact geography, the town plays a significant role in the social and cultural landscape of the Eastern Province.

Kattankudy offers a unique blend of tradition and progress, making it a fascinating destination for those seeking to explore Sri Lanka’s rich Muslim heritage and coastal charm.

🗺️ Geographical Overview of Kattankudy

Kattankudy is a densely populated coastal town in Sri Lanka’s Eastern Province, located just south of Batticaloa city. It lies along the eastern seaboard facing the Indian Ocean, bordered by the scenic Batticaloa Lagoon to the west. This town is known for its compact size, vibrant Muslim community, and strong commercial presence.

Despite being one of the smallest towns geographically, Kattankudy plays a significant role in the region’s cultural and economic landscape. It is characterized by urban density, community-based infrastructure, and religious landmarks, including dozens of historic mosques and madrasas. The town's location provides easy access to coastal and inland resources, making it both a spiritual and economic hub in the Batticaloa District.

🌍 Location & Surroundings

  • Province: Eastern Province
  • District: Batticaloa District
  • Coordinates: Approx. 7.68° N, 81.73° E
  • Nearest City: Batticaloa (~5 km north)
  • Distance from Colombo: ~305 km

💼 Local Economy & Livelihoods in Kattankudy

Kattankudy, located along Sri Lanka’s eastern coastline, is one of the most densely populated urban areas in the country. The town’s economy is largely driven by trade, commerce, education, and fishing, supported by its strategic location near Batticaloa and access to the A4 highway. Its bustling markets and business hubs reflect the strong entrepreneurial spirit of the local Muslim community.

In addition to trade, Kattankudy’s residents engage in fishing, small-scale manufacturing, services, and food production. Traditional industries like textile shops, tailoring, and halal food preparation are prominent, while education and religious scholarship also contribute to economic activity. Many households operate home-based businesses, adding to the town’s vibrant microeconomy.

📈 Key Economic Activities

  • Retail trade and market-based commerce across various sectors.
  • Small-scale industries including tailoring, sweets, and textiles.
  • Fishing in the Batticaloa Lagoon and nearby coastal waters.
  • Education and religious services through madrasas and private schools.
  • Transportation, food stalls, and home-based enterprises.

🚌 Transportation & Accessibility in Kattankudy

Kattankudy, a bustling town in Sri Lanka’s Eastern Province, enjoys excellent connectivity due to its proximity to Batticaloa city. It benefits from well-developed road networks and local transport services, facilitating easy movement within the Eastern region.

The A4 highway, passing near Kattankudy, links the town directly with Batticaloa and extends westward to Polonnaruwa and Colombo. Frequent bus services connect Kattankudy to nearby towns such as Kalmunai, Eravur, and beyond, supporting daily commuting and trade.

🚆 Rail Connectivity

While Kattankudy does not have its own railway station, the nearby Batticaloa Railway Station provides convenient access to the Colombo–Batticaloa rail line, offering an affordable and scenic travel option for residents.

✈️ Nearest Airports

  • Batticaloa Airport (BTC): Located just a few kilometers away, providing limited domestic flights.
  • China Bay Airport (TRR) – Trincomalee: Approximately 110 km north, offering additional domestic air connectivity.

🚍 Local Transportation

  • Frequent bus routes and private minibuses serving Kattankudy and surrounding areas.
  • Three-wheelers (tuk-tuks) widely used for short-distance travel within the town.
  • Motorcycles and bicycles are common for personal transport.
  • Taxi and rental vehicle services available for visitors and business needs.
